- Seasonal Performance: The 3PMSF-rated rubber compound remains pliable in winter conditions while resisting heat degradation in summer. Hybrid tread design combines grooves for wet and dry braking with snow biting edges for winter grip. This is a true year-round tire suitable for mild-to-moderate Canadian winters; severe snow regions benefit from dedicated winter tires.
